Skip to content

Commit 15be5ce

Browse files
committed
[WeeklyReport] algorithm1832 2026.02.23~2026.03.08
1 parent 322a495 commit 15be5ce

File tree

1 file changed

+58
-0
lines changed

1 file changed

+58
-0
lines changed
Lines changed: 58 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,58 @@
1+
### 姓名
2+
3+
杨锃砚
4+
5+
6+
7+
### 实习项目
8+
9+
Paddle API兼容性增强
10+
11+
12+
13+
### 本双周工作
14+
15+
1. **兼容性装饰器的报错提示信息优化**
16+
17+
- https://github.com/PaddlePaddle/Paddle/pull/77916
18+
- 状态:已合入
19+
- 所属:衍生的杂项任务
20+
- 描述:
21+
- 更新参数别名装饰器的报错提示,新的提示内容为"无法同时指定原参数和别名"
22+
23+
2. **文档中添加参数别名说明**
24+
25+
- https://github.com/PaddlePaddle/Paddle/pull/77935
26+
- https://github.com/PaddlePaddle/docs/pull/7675
27+
- 状态:已合入
28+
- 所属:兼容性增强任务
29+
- 描述:
30+
- 向中英文文档补充了参数别名的说明
31+
- 此工作属于重复性高的工作,或可使用agent完成
32+
33+
3. **`paddle.autograd.PyLayerContext`添加别名**
34+
35+
- https://github.com/PaddlePaddle/Paddle/pull/78114
36+
- 状态:Paddle仓库审阅中
37+
- 所属:兼容性增强任务
38+
- 描述:
39+
- 涉及到文档中五个API别名
40+
- 通过在对应的包添加导入来实现API别名
41+
42+
4. **`paddle.utils.data`添加别名**
43+
44+
- https://github.com/PaddlePaddle/Paddle/pull/78204
45+
- 状态:已提交PR
46+
- 所属:兼容性增强任务
47+
- 描述:
48+
- 原先`paddle.utils.data`中的API已经通过添加导入的方式添加别名,然而在后续的PaConvert检查中,发现其中方法还存在一些文档内没写的别名(如`paddle.utils.data._utils.default_collate`),这些调用方式是随着PyTorch的演化产生的,此PR添加了这一部分的别名
49+
- 整理了paddle.utils.data文件夹的结构,使别名能够被正确调用
50+
51+
**[*] 本周有其它事务处理,时间受限**
52+
53+
### 下双周工作
54+
55+
1. 对于已完成的兼容性增强任务,修改PaConvert和文档
56+
2. 如有时间剩余,继续认领完成其它任务(预计开展以下API的兼容性工作:`paddle.Tensor.cuda`, `paddle.Tensor.is_cpu`, `paddle.Tensor.nelement``torch.nn.ReLU`
57+
58+

0 commit comments

Comments
 (0)